M J Murphy Beauty College of Mount Pleasant vs. Port Huron Cosmetology

Both M J Murphy Beauty College of Mount Pleasant and Port Huron Cosmetology College are Private, Less than 2 years schools located in Michigan. The following statements compare M J Murphy Beauty College of Mount Pleasant and Port Huron Cosmetology College with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• Port Huron Cosmetology's tuition ($19,800) is more expensive than M J Murphy Beauty College of Mount Pleasant ($16,200).
  • Both schools have same students to faculty ratio of 10 to 1.
  • Port Huron Cosmetology (52 students) is larger than M J Murphy Beauty College of Mount Pleasant (35 students) with more enrolled students.
  • M J Murphy Beauty College of Mount Pleasant ($6,205) has higher amount of financial aid than Port Huron Cosmetology ($3,778).
  • M J Murphy Beauty College of Mount Pleasant's graduation rate (93%) is higher than Port Huron Cosmetology (68%).
